Description
Long, long ago, there was an ancient kingdom called Ys which prospered under the auspices of two heavenly Goddesses. Over time, the kingdom came to be known as Esteria, and its divine history was largely forgotten by all but the descendants of those who once preached the Goddesses’ will. The only reminder of this lost lore was a cursed spire at the foot of a giant crater, which locals came to regard as “The Devil’s Tower.”

Eventually, the men and women who called Esteria their home began mining a uniquely radiant silver from the nearby mountains, and development boomed. Towns were built, and the land became rich with life.

Then, all at once, monsters began to appear. Only a few at first – but soon enough, the land was swarming with them, and the Esterians had no choice but to hide in fear, remaining ever vigilant just to stay alive.

Our story begins with a young man who’d heard rumors of these misfortunes, and strove to verify them with his own eyes; a brave swordsman with an adventurous spirit bolstered by his own youthful naiveté.

His name was Adol Christin.

With no regard for his own safety, Adol set sail toward Esteria through a heretofore impassable barrier of neverending storms. There, he was destined to become ensconced within a 700 year-old mystery that would ultimately take him to a long-lost land nestled amongst the clouds...

Ys I & II Chronicles+ is the most modernized and up-to-date remake of Falcom’s classic franchise-spawning action RPGs from 1987 and 1988. Come see how the story began, and witness the birth of a legend!
  • Classic buttonless “bump” combat receives a full analog-enabled upgrade for gamepad users, and is augmented in Ys II by a robust magic system.
  • Soundtrack selectable from among the original 80s FM-synth, an early 2000s MIDI-style remix or a modern studio performance by Falcom’s in-house rock band.
  • Character art selectable from 90s-style portraits or more modern anime designs.
  • Four selectable difficulty levels and optional boss rush mode grant players a true old-school challenge.

Good for what it is

I wanted to get into the Ys series for a while, and I was always a bit put off after watching gameplay videos. Turns out, the bump-to-attack mechanic was quite fun. It's not deep, there are no different builds or tactics to it, but for an old game this works fine. Bosses are the real highlights, and as I understand, they will remain so in all Ys games. What I was also worried about was writing, and it is also important to understand that this game represents its time. You just didn't get much better writing in an action RPG. If something like this gets released today in a fully priced JRPG game, it won't be accepted well. It is not bad, but it is not great at all. But I am hoping that getting to know the characters and events in Ys I and II will help me appreciate later games more, and after spending a couple of hours with Ys Origin, I am glad that I completed these two games. Like some other reviewers mentioned, there will be moments where you might not know waht to do. Don't waste too much of your time on figuring out what to do, use the guide. Overall, these two games are well worthy of your time. They are good old games.

The original epic action JRPG

This combination of YS Books I & II is a remaster of the first two games in a series that started in the 1980s on Japanese PCs long before other action RPG franchises appeared. While that means updated visuals, sound, accessibility, and some quality of life features vs. the originals. If you weren't around for those days long ago keep in mind that games of this vintage were a little more quirky and don't always explain things. The 'bump-combat' style is one of those unique and quirky aspects; it seems odd at first, but once you get used to it you can see that it leads to a fairly quick-paced combat flow with lots of movement which is what they were going for. Part of this older style also means they expect you to explore everything, and experiment with your equipment/items around the environment to uncover things organically. The thought would also be that you'd probably replay the game, which means something you missed could surprise you on a replay. The side effect of that is that it becomes really easy to miss things or not be aware of something as it doesn't drop much in terms of hints. If you don't want spoilers, but don't want to miss things have multiple saves and before any boss fight check a guide for anything you missed up to that point. I originally played this on a game console called the TurboGrafx-16 CD (PC-Engine CD in Japan) released in 1990 (1989 Japan). With that being the first CD game console and this game being one of the first CD games in existence with two sizable (for the time) games combined into one package with enhanced graphics, anime cut-scenes, voice-acting, and a CD audio soundtrack (vs. just chip-tunes) it was amazing. Replaying this using Gentoo Linux via Proton 9.0-203 compatibility layer with env var PROTON_USE_WINED3D=1, regedit to "DisableHidraw"/"Enable SDL" for controller support, and disabling movie playback via the config.exe. Works great!

A true classic arpg

Ys 1&2 is a retro arpg with a unique fighting system(the bump system) you just run into enemies trying to be slightly off their center in order to damage them while if you run into them straight on you exchange blows resulting in you taking dmg also. Save yourself the trouble and use a guide on this one the game was made in a different gaming era and ys1 is rather short(it took me around 6 hours to finish) if you know what to do. I completely disagree with those that say that the game is painfully difficult(I played on normal), most bosses are easy and the few that are not just requires you to get their rhythm down, no boss took me more than 5 tries. The music is phenomenal, the tunes match the action on the screen to a T and the boss fight music pumps you up. To conclude ys1&2 is a really charming and enjoyable retro game, going into it expecting modern game design is nonsensical since they were made in 1987 and 1988 but they hold up remarkably well.
